On July 1, the Council of Ministers approved a decrease in the line of participatory loans to projects of technology companies of 18.6 million euros, from the 20.4 million euros originally envisaged in the Council of Ministers of April 29 to 1.7 million euros in the end. A reduction by implementing the agreement of lack of availability of credits in the 2016 State Budget amounting to 2 billion euros.

In May 2016, we went to Lima to see for ourselves the new ways of working that BBVA is introducing throughout the organization to accelerate its transformation. For two days, BBVA Continental teams met to participate in a quarterly planning session. The goal is to decide on the projects for the next three months and determine the tasks that must be carried out to make them a reality. "Agile methodologies have proven to be a model that works and really get people excited,” affirms Karina Bruce, Talent and Culture Manager at BBVA Continental.
